Product specifications
R01AN0168ED0101 Rev. 01.01 13
Application Note
Chapter 3 About Stepper Motor Movement
3.2 The PWM Generation of ISM
Following a Prescaler (GTB), the central Time Base determines the PWM 
output of ISM; this means that all PWM outputs of ISM are having the same 
frequency and are all synchronous.
In order to avoid that too many edges are occurring at the same time on 
several ports, each PWM output can be assigned to a delay, which is set in 
clocks of the central time base (
CDVn and CDHn).
The level of the PWM is in the range 0 ... 2
10
- 1, where 0 means no PWM 
output (0%), and 2
10
-1 sets the output level to full 100%. The zero level (0%) 
output is important to allow to switch off the output completely. 100% level is 
achieved, because the PWM compare value can be set one count more than 
the range of counting of the timebase.
The duty cycle of the PWM is set by defining the values 
CHPn and CVPn, for 
each channel, for the horizontal and vertical PWM, respectively. As the 
maximum count c of the Channel Timebase is 2
10
- 2, and the duty cycle is 
given by a/(c+1), the following formula is given for the duty cycle P:
Figure 3-3 PWM Generation of ISM
P%
CHP
2
10
1–
------------------=
P%
CVP
2
10
1–
------------------=
F
&KDQQHO7LPHEDVH&RXQW9DOXH
D
F
D  D 
D 
D F
D F
D 
&RPSDUHPDWFKKDVSULRULW\
RYHU7LPHEDVH=HUR(YHQW
D 
D 
D F
0DWFKQHYHURFFXUVRQO\
7LPHEDVH=HUR(YHQWV
F 
F 
3:0 
3:0 
3:0 FF
3:0 F
3:0 DF
&RPSDUH
0DWFK










